Understanding the Role of Predictive Maintenance in Fleet Performance Optimization

Fleet management is a critical aspect of many businesses that rely on transportation for their operations. Ensuring that vehicles are in optimal condition is essential for maintaining efficiency and reducing unexpected breakdowns. Predictive maintenance plays a key role in this by utilizing data and analytics to anticipate potential issues before they occur. By proactively addressing maintenance needs, fleet managers can minimize downtime and keep their vehicles running smoothly.

The use of predictive maintenance not only helps prevent costly repairs but also improves overall safety for drivers and passengers. By staying ahead of maintenance schedules based on data-driven insights, fleet managers can address potential safety concerns before they escalate into serious issues. Additionally, predictive maintenance allows for better planning and resource allocation, optimizing the performance of the fleet while reducing operational risks.

What is predictive maintenance?

Predictive maintenance is a proactive maintenance strategy that uses data and analytics to predict when equipment or vehicles are likely to fail, allowing for timely maintenance to be scheduled before a breakdown occurs.
